The INA138-Q1 and INA168-Q1 (INA1x8-Q1) devices are high-side, unidirectional, current
sense amplifiers. Wide input common-mode voltage range, low quiescent current, and TSSOP and SOT-23
packaging enable use in a variety of applications.
Input common-mode and power-supply voltages are independent, and range from 2.7 V to 36 V
for the INA138-Q1, and 2.7 V to 60 V for the INA168-Q1. Quiescent current is only 25 µA, which
permits connecting the power supply to either side of the current-measurement shunt with minimal
error.
The device converts a differential input voltage to a current output. This current is
converted back to a voltage with an external load resistor that sets any gain from 1 to over 100.
Although designed for current shunt measurement, the circuit invites creative applications in
measurement and level shifting.
Both devices are available in a TSSOP-8 package. The INA168-Q1 is also available in a
SOT-23-5 package. Both devices are specified for the –40°C to +125°C temperature range.
